Solution for 3y^2+y-10= equation:


Simplifying
3y2 + y + -10 = 0

Reorder the terms:
-10 + y + 3y2 = 0

Solving
-10 + y + 3y2 = 0

Solving for variable 'y'.

Factor a trinomial.
(-2 + -1y)(5 + -3y) = 0

Subproblem 1

Set the factor '(-2 + -1y)' equal to zero and attempt to solve: Simplifying -2 + -1y = 0 Solving -2 + -1y = 0 Move all terms containing y to the left, all other terms to the right. Add '2' to each side of the equation. -2 + 2 + -1y = 0 + 2 Combine like terms: -2 + 2 = 0 0 + -1y = 0 + 2 -1y = 0 + 2 Combine like terms: 0 + 2 = 2 -1y = 2 Divide each side by '-1'. y = -2 Simplifying y = -2

Subproblem 2

Set the factor '(5 + -3y)' equal to zero and attempt to solve: Simplifying 5 + -3y = 0 Solving 5 + -3y = 0 Move all terms containing y to the left, all other terms to the right. Add '-5' to each side of the equation. 5 + -5 + -3y = 0 + -5 Combine like terms: 5 + -5 = 0 0 + -3y = 0 + -5 -3y = 0 + -5 Combine like terms: 0 + -5 = -5 -3y = -5 Divide each side by '-3'. y = 1.666666667 Simplifying y = 1.666666667

Solution

y = {-2, 1.666666667}
